Context
The dataset tabulates the population of Plymouth by gender across 18 age groups. It lists the male and female population in each age group along with the gender ratio for Plymouth. The dataset can be utilized to understand the population distribution of Plymouth by gender and age. For example, using this dataset, we can identify the largest age group for both Men and Women in Plymouth. Additionally, it can be used to see how the gender ratio changes from birth to senior most age group and male to female ratio across each age group for Plymouth.
Key observations
Largest age group (population): Male # 25-29 years (584) | Female # 15-19 years (523). Source: U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S) 2019-2023 5-Year Estimates.
When available, the data consists of estimates from the U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S) 2019-2023 5-Year Estimates.

Scope of gender :
Please note that American Community Survey asks a question about the respondents current sex, but not about gender, sexual orientation, or sex at birth. The question is intended to capture data for biological sex, not gender. Respondents are supposed to respond with the answer as either of Male or Female. Our research and this dataset mirrors the data reported as Male and Female for gender distribution analysis.

Data showing the self-reported health of Plymouth's residents in 2011 . Source: Office for National Statistics This data shows numbers who answered to the Question of “Do you consider yourself to have bad health” in the Census of 2011. The data shows the total people in the ward and the total of people who ticked yes they consider themselves to have bad health. This data is collected every 10 years by the National Census the next one is due in 2023. This Data is taken from the National Census of 2011 and was last updated in Jan 2013 it is next due to be updated in 2023.
